Talk to your doctor about what to do if your child misses a dose of the anti-seizure drug Onfi (clobazam). Depending on when you realize he didn't take the medicine, he may be able to take the missed dose right away and then take the next dose as scheduled. However, if it's almost time for the next dose, your doctor may recommend skipping the missed dose and resuming the usual schedule with the next dose. Do not double the dose, since taking too much Onfi may increase the risk of serious side effects.
